GB News: Hope of a quick end to Ukraine war is 'wishful thinking' says James Heappey
James Heappey, former armed forces minister, douses hopes for a quick end to the war in Ukraine, labeling such optimism as wishful thinking. He urges continued Western support for Ukraine, despite acknowledging the grinding stalemate and high costs on both sides.
He calls out Labour's defense spending plans as contradictory, highlighting the danger of budget cuts in geopolitical times. If new funding isn't secured, increased troop pay could come at the cost of critical military resources.

GB News: Columbia University president steps down after MONTHS of Gaza protests on campus
Columbia University's president, Minouche Shafik, has resigned amid a storm of protests related to the Gaza conflict that spanned 13 months. Her departure follows accusations of inadequate responses to antisemitism and intense campus unrest, prompting her to step down for new leadership.
Shafik noted the toll on her family and the difficulties in bridging community divides during her tenure. She leaves to focus on international development in the UK, noting the turmoil she faced personally and within the university environment.
The Economist: Britain’s government is mapping underground cable and pipes
In Britain, a tangled mess of 4 million kilometers of underground cables and pipes lies hidden, waiting for a careless dig. Every seven seconds, someone disturbs the earth, risking power outages and leaks, while the government scrambles to map this unseen network to ward off trouble.
To handle both accidental strikes and possible sabotage, a new initiative is underway, but the truth is buried deeper than the infrastructure itself. The stakes are high; one wrong move could send the country into chaos.

GB News: Mike Tyson and Jake Paul fight 'may get stopped' with boxing icon 'too old' to return to the ring
A boxing showdown between Mike Tyson and Jake Paul is on the horizon, but doubts loom. Aloys Junior warns that health concerns could halt the fight, citing Tyson's age and recent health issues, while Butterbean deems the spectacle a mere publicity stunt.
Tyson insists he's ready, but many question if the bout will ever happen.
